Fan-out backpressure for the Quillet notifier: when the queue depth crosses the soft limit, the dispatcher sheds low-priority pushes and batches the rest at 500ms intervals. Reviewer should confirm the shed counter is exported and that retries respect the jitter window. Once merged, the release artifact gets re-signed by the pipeline, which expects the deploy key shown below.

deploy key for bawep-yawif: bky6_GQhaSt

DeployBot: No status replies

If the Shipbeam chat bot ignores /deploy-status, check plugin registration first. Unregistered plugins are silently dropped. Re-register, then confirm the webhook handshake returns 200. If replies are delayed, the event queue is likely backed up; retry after 60 seconds. For direct API checks against the status service, authenticate with the token below.

session JWT of yawep-yawep = eyJhbGciOiJIUzI1NiIsInR5cCI6IkpXVCJ9.eyJzdWIiOiI3pWF3_In0.aXYsHiog

Onboarding: PortionWise scaling engine

PortionWise converts recipe yields using rational arithmetic, never floats, to avoid rounding drift on repeated scaling. When reviewing changes, check that unit conversions route through the Granary table and that scaling factors below 0.25 trigger the "small batch" warning path. Test fixtures live in the Breadline suite. If a fixture seems wrong rather than the code, confirm with the recipes team at the address below.

alerts address for bawif-hahig: norwyn_gorys_lamath@olvarqlabs.test

**Ticket #2093 — permessage-deflate: worth it for plugin channels?**

Hey plugin folks — we enabled websocket compression on the Fernwick gateway and saw bandwidth drop ~60%, but CPU on small instances spiked and a few plugins reported latency blips. Proposal: make compression opt-in per channel via the manifest. Weigh in if your plugin sends lots of tiny frames; those compress badly. Test against the staging build identified below.

build token for kagaf-hahof: htk14_9d3d4d26d7d8de